Dilution In Microbiology . Dilutions are used many times during the semester in the microbiology lab, for a variety of purposes. The dilution of microbes is very important to get to microbes diluted enough to count on a spread plate (described later). Serial dilutions are routinely used in microbiology to estimate the number of microorganisms in a sample with an unknown concentration. Learn how to solve a dilution problem. In microbiology, serial dilution estimates viable organisms (number of yeasts, bacteria, viruses, or bacteriophage) present in a sample by backtracking the measured concentration of the most diluted solution to the unknown concentration.
